package org.apache.chemistry.opencmis.client.bindings.spi.atompub;
import java.io.IOException;
import java.io.OutputStream;
import org.apache.chemistry.opencmis.client.bindings.spi.BindingSession;
import org.apache.chemistry.opencmis.client.bindings.spi.http.Output;
import org.apache.chemistry.opencmis.commons.data.ExtensionsData;
import org.apache.chemistry.opencmis.commons.exceptions.CmisInvalidArgumentException;
import org.apache.chemistry.opencmis.commons.exceptions.CmisObjectNotFoundException;
import org.apache.chemistry.opencmis.commons.impl.Constants;
import org.apache.chemistry.opencmis.commons.impl.UrlBuilder;
import org.apache.chemistry.opencmis.commons.spi.MultiFilingService;
/**
* MultiFiling Service AtomPub client.
*/
public class MultiFilingServiceImpl extends AbstractAtomPubService implements MultiFilingService {
/**
* Constructor.
*/
public MultiFilingServiceImpl(BindingSession session) {
setSession(session);
}
public void addObjectToFolder(String repositoryId, String objectId, String folderId, Boolean allVersions,
ExtensionsData extension) {
if (objectId == null) {
throw new CmisInvalidArgumentException("Object id must be set!");
}
// find the link
String link = loadLink(repositoryId, folderId, Constants.REL_DOWN, Constants.MEDIATYPE_CHILDREN);
if (link == null) {
throwLinkException(repositoryId, folderId, Constants.REL_DOWN, Constants.MEDIATYPE_CHILDREN);
}
UrlBuilder url = new UrlBuilder(link);
url.addParameter(Constants.PARAM_ALL_VERSIONS, allVersions);
// set up object and writer
final AtomEntryWriter entryWriter = new AtomEntryWriter(createIdObject(objectId), getCmisVersion(repositoryId));
// post addObjectToFolder request
post(url, Constants.MEDIATYPE_ENTRY, new Output() {
public void write(OutputStream out) throws IOException {
entryWriter.write(out);
}
});
}
public void removeObjectFromFolder(String repositoryId, String objectId, String folderId, ExtensionsData extension) {
if (objectId == null) {
throw new CmisInvalidArgumentException("Object id must be set!");
}
// find the link
String link = loadCollection(repositoryId, Constants.COLLECTION_UNFILED);
if (link == null) {
throw new CmisObjectNotFoundException("Unknown repository or unfiling not supported!");
}
UrlBuilder url = new UrlBuilder(link);
url.addParameter(Constants.PARAM_REMOVE_FROM, folderId);
// set up object and writer
final AtomEntryWriter entryWriter = new AtomEntryWriter(createIdObject(objectId), getCmisVersion(repositoryId));
// post removeObjectFromFolder request
post(url, Constants.MEDIATYPE_ENTRY, new Output() {
public void write(OutputStream out) throws IOException {
entryWriter.write(out);
}
});
}
}
